/etc/hosts.conf和/etc/resolv.conf区别
时间: 2023-10-31 10:34:57 浏览: 181
ubuntu网络重启后或主机重启后,_etc_resolv.conf恢复原样的解决办法 - 正风三才的博客 - CSDN博客1
`/etc/hosts.conf` 文件是一个本地的文本文件,用于将主机名映射到 IP 地址。当计算机需要连接到一个主机时,它会首先查找 `/etc/hosts.conf` 文件,以确定该主机名对应的 IP 地址。如果主机名在该文件中不存在,则计算机会继续查询 DNS 服务器以获取 IP 地址。
`/etc/resolv.conf` 文件是一个用于配置 DNS 解析器的本地文件。它指定了 DNS 解析器应该使用哪些 DNS 服务器以及查询域名时应该使用哪些搜索后缀。当计算机需要解析一个域名时,它会首先查找 `/etc/resolv.conf` 文件,以确定应使用哪些 DNS 服务器进行查询。
因此,这两个文件的作用不同,但都与网络连接和域名解析有关。
阅读全文